aboutsummaryrefslogtreecommitdiff
path: root/engines/fullpipe/fullpipe.h
diff options
context:
space:
mode:
authorEugene Sandulenko2016-11-25 18:44:14 +0100
committerEugene Sandulenko2016-11-25 18:53:16 +0100
commit1523f987c38cdebcaa351ef1e05f3f7e81a9ce92 (patch)
treec761f7fd649c3850bbc897d619439f5f7a84eb4a /engines/fullpipe/fullpipe.h
parent4d8cc0db680184d9a38d13d35d89e26dc02beabc (diff)
downloadscummvm-rg350-1523f987c38cdebcaa351ef1e05f3f7e81a9ce92.tar.gz
scummvm-rg350-1523f987c38cdebcaa351ef1e05f3f7e81a9ce92.tar.bz2
scummvm-rg350-1523f987c38cdebcaa351ef1e05f3f7e81a9ce92.zip
FULLPIPE: Added 4 sound channels like in original
Diffstat (limited to 'engines/fullpipe/fullpipe.h')
-rw-r--r--engines/fullpipe/fullpipe.h8
1 files changed, 7 insertions, 1 deletions
diff --git a/engines/fullpipe/fullpipe.h b/engines/fullpipe/fullpipe.h
index d8f438b3da..9b755a6504 100644
--- a/engines/fullpipe/fullpipe.h
+++ b/engines/fullpipe/fullpipe.h
@@ -182,6 +182,7 @@ public:
void playSound(int id, int flag);
void playTrack(GameVar *sceneVar, const char *name, bool delayed);
int getSceneTrack();
+ void updateTrackDelay();
void startSceneTrack();
void startSoundStream1(char *trackName);
void stopSoundStream2();
@@ -327,7 +328,12 @@ public:
void lift_openLift();
GameVar *_musicGameVar;
- Audio::SoundHandle *_sceneTrackHandle;
+ Audio::SoundHandle *_soundStream1;
+ Audio::SoundHandle *_soundStream2;
+ Audio::SoundHandle *_soundStream3;
+ Audio::SoundHandle *_soundStream4;
+
+ bool _stream2playing;
public: